The Premier Hockey Federation, previously known as the National Women's Hockey League, has recently announced that they will be doubling their salary cap for next season.
This is massive news for the teams and players of the PHF, but it is not a good look for the NHL.
This news breaks just as Gary Bettman announced that the NHL will increase their salary cap by $1M.
So, while the PHF is raising their salary cap by 100%, the NHL is raising their salary cap by 1.2%.
This is bad for the NHL, who has so much more money than the PHF, but is only able to raise the cap by 1.2%.
